WebGlobally, grandparents often serve as surrogate parents for their grandchildren, usually in response to family crises and other sociopolitical issues (e.g., poverty, war, disease epidemics, and urban migration). Grandparents raising grandchildren are primarily responsible for all aspects of their grandchildren’s care. WebJul 3, 2024 · Why Would I Want To Find My Grandparents? WebAug 22, 2024 · National Grandparents Day: September 11, 2024. From the U.S. Census Bureau’s Facts for Features: National Grandparents Day 2024: “In 1970, Marian McQuade initiated a campaign to establish a day to honor grandparents. In 1978, President Jimmy Carter signed a federal proclamation, declaring the first Sunday after Labor Day as …
